ST. PAUL, MInn. - Michael Gutierrez of Macalester hit a three-pointer with four seconds to go in the game to defeat the St. Olaf men's basketball team 64-61 on Saturday afternoon at the Leonard Center.
Robert Tobroxen and
Austin Majeskie had 13 points and eight rebounds apiece for St. Olaf (10-12, 8-9 MIAC).
Matthew Stroud chipped in eight points.
Gutierrez was 8-for-12 from three-point range for the Scots (10-12, 8-9 MIAC), who shot 44.8 percent from the three-point line on the day as a team.Â
The Oles had 28 points in the paitn to Macalester's 14 and was 78.6 percent from the free throw line.
St. Olaf will host St. Thomas next on Monday at 7 p.m.
